Why visit Montenegro?

Montenegro is one of Europe's last great secrets, a jewel-box nation where Venetian-walled Kotor tumbles down to a shimmering Adriatic bay, and the wild Durmitor National Park rises into snowcapped peaks above the breathtaking Tara River Canyon. Wander the amber-lit lanes of Budva's medieval old town, sip a glass of robust Vranac wine on a terrace overlooking the Bay of Boka, and feast on freshly caught branzino drizzled in local olive oil at a harbour-side konoba. Discover the serene monastery of Ostrog carved impossibly into a sheer cliff face, or kayak through the mirror-still waters of Lake Skadar as pelicans glide overhead. This is a country where Ottoman, Venetian and Slavic cultures collide in the most delicious ways, where luxury and raw wilderness exist within a short drive of each other, and where every corner feels cinematic and untouched. When to go to Montenegro

The best months for Montenegro are May, June, July, August and September. Highs then sit around 27°C, crowds are medium at peak, and a week here is mid-priced.

What is the weather like in Montenegro?

July is the warmest month, with daytime highs around 30°C. January is the coolest, around 12°C by day and 6°C at night. November is the wettest, with about 17 wet days. Figures are measured averages, not estimates.

What is Montenegro known for?

Montenegro is best known for nature, history, beaches, mountains and culture. The things people come for: Venetian Kotor, Ostrog cliff monastery, Tara River Canyon, Lake Skadar.
